Goffle Road Poultry Farm, based in Wyckoff, NJ, received $4.2 million from the US Department of Agriculture as part of the more than $223 million grants and loans distributed nationwide to smaller, independent processors.
Acting on a directive from the Biden-Harris administration, the US Department of Agriculture is offering more than $223 million in grants and loans toward growing competition and expanding meat and poultry processing capacity in the United States.
Saputo Inc. announced its mozzarella cheese manufacturing facility in Reedsburg, Wis., will be converted into a plant for producing goat cheese. Meanwhile, one of its other facilities will close.
Home Chef, a subsidiary of The Kroger Co., is opening a new production facility near Atlanta. The meal kit company leased a 181,000-square-foot facility in Douglasville, Ga.
An on-farm sustainability collaboration between Bel Brands USA and Dairy Farmers of America found certain practices both reduced greenhouse gas emissions and increased milk production.
With the $2 million allocated by the Oregon Legislature, the Oregon Department of Agriculture (ODA) chose six meat processors who will receive the Oregon Meat Processing Infrastructure and Capacity Building Grant to expand meat processing capacity of Oregon-raised livestock statewide.
